    I apologize for getting off topic in my initial posts, as I was bringing U.S. gun restriction proposals into this thread about Canada. As for the O.P., I do agree with more strict background checks and most of the items on the list for Canada. However these couple are just totally absurd to me:

    7. Disclose the names and contact information of all conjugal partners in the last two years. These former and current partners are contacted to see if they have any concerns regarding the individual’s acquisition of a firearm.

    Ok, so some woman who you broke up with for another woman and may hold a grudge against you should be able to lie and restrict you from obtaining a firearm? I could see looking into restraining orders, but just word of mouth from anyone you had a conjugal encounter with is a little over the top.


    9. Disclose whether you have threatened or attempted suicide, any consultation or treatment for alcohol, substance abuse, and behavioral or emotional problems in the last 5 years.

    Does this mean that if you have sought out treatment like AA or any other substance abuse that you should not be able to own a firearm? If so, that's wrong and alienates substance abuse and people with mild depression. Basically any firearms owner would be afraid to seek out treatment for fear of having their guns confiscated.

    Violance offences and severe mental disorders are one thing. Someone seeking treatment for substance abuse, or for mild depression is another thing.

    When I applied for my PAL, none of the people I put on the list were contacted. Even my wife didn't get the phone call. Come to think about it, my character references didn't get called either. Maybe I'm just that good of a guy.

    My friend that has his restricted license was treated for anxiety and take meds for it. All was disclosed on the application and he got it anyway. So I don't think it's a auto deny if you answer yes to those questions.
